Managed-WP.™

WordPress Modular DS Privilege Escalation Vulnerability | CVE202623800 | 2026-01-16


Plugin Name Modular DS
Type of Vulnerability Privilege escalation
CVE Number CVE-2026-23800
Urgency Critical
CVE Publish Date 2026-01-16
Source URL CVE-2026-23800

Critical Privilege Escalation in Modular DS (≤ 2.5.2): Essential Guidance for WordPress Site Administrators

Executive Summary: A critical unauthenticated privilege escalation vulnerability (CVE-2026-23800) affecting the WordPress plugin Modular DS versions up to 2.5.2 was publicly disclosed and patched in 2.6.0. This flaw enables attackers to elevate privileges without authentication, risking full site compromise. With a maximum CVSS score and confirmed exploitation, this vulnerability demands immediate attention. In this briefing, we guide you through understanding the risk, identification, swift remediation, and comprehensive defense strategies. Our recommendations derive from frontline WordPress incident response and advanced WAF engineering expertise.


Table of Contents

  • Overview of the Vulnerability and Its Criticality
  • Scope and Impact: Who is at Risk?
  • Attack Vector Overview: How Exploitation Occurs
  • Urgent Remediation Steps: Technical and Operational
  • Detection Methods and Indicators of Compromise (IoCs)
  • Post-Compromise Handling: Incident Containment and Recovery
  • Strengthening Defenses: Best Practices and Hardening
  • Role of Web Application Firewalls (WAF) and Virtual Patching
  • Guidance for Developers: Avoiding Privilege Escalation Errors
  • Recommendations for Hosting Providers and Agencies
  • Why Choose Managed-WP for Your WordPress Security Needs
  • Appendix: Useful WP-CLI Commands and Operational Checklist

Overview of the Vulnerability and Its Criticality

The Modular DS plugin for WordPress, prior to version 2.6.0, contains a privilege escalation vulnerability allowing unauthenticated users to gain elevated access rights. Attackers exploiting this can completely takeover sites by creating administrative users or executing restricted actions.

Critical details include:

  • Vulnerability Type: Privilege Escalation
  • Authentication Requirement: None (Unauthenticated)
  • Impact: Full site takeover with administrative privileges
  • OWASP Reference: Identification and Authentication Failures
  • Severity: CVSS 10.0 (Critical)
  • Exploit Status: Active exploitation in the wild

This vulnerability enables attackers to bypass normal access controls, posing a severe threat to site integrity and confidentiality. Immediate patching or mitigation is vital.


Scope and Impact: Who is at Risk?

  • All WordPress installations running Modular DS version 2.5.2 or earlier.
  • Sites with inactive installations but exposed plugin endpoints.
  • Sites unable to perform immediate updates due to operational constraints remain vulnerable.

Due to widespread usage, the attack surface is extensive, making automated mass exploitation likely.


Attack Vector Overview: How Exploitation Occurs

Attackers typically follow these phases:

  • Reconnaissance: Scanning for Modular DS instances and vulnerable versions.
  • Unauthenticated Access: Triggering plugin endpoints lacking proper authentication and capability checks.
  • Privilege Escalation: Elevating user privileges to administrative levels.
  • Persistence and Abuse: Installing backdoors, creating accounts, exfiltrating data, or leveraging the server for further malicious activity.
  • Lateral Movement: Exploiting shared hosting environments to compromise additional sites.

This attack pathway’s severity is compounded by the lack of required credentials.


Urgent Remediation Steps: Technical and Operational

Implement the following actions immediately, prioritizing sites with significant user traffic or sensitive data:

  1. Upgrade Modular DS to version 2.6.0 or higher immediately.
  2. If immediate upgrade is not feasible:
    • Deactivate or disable the plugin.
    • Apply WAF virtual patches or firewall rules blocking exploit patterns.
    • Restrict backend access via IP whitelisting where applicable.
  3. Reset Credentials: Change all admin passwords and rotate API keys and tokens.
  4. Conduct Malware and Integrity Scans: Check for unauthorized files, changes, and suspicious activity.
  5. Notify Stakeholders: Inform your teams, customers, and hosting providers as necessary.

Detection Methods and Indicators of Compromise (IoCs)

  • Sudden creation or modification of administrator users.
  • Unrecognized scheduled tasks or cron jobs.
  • New or altered PHP files in sensitive directories.
  • Unexpected plugin or theme installations.
  • Unusual HTTP POST or GET requests targeting plugin endpoints.
  • Outbound connections to suspicious remote servers.
  • Malicious content or redirection injected into site pages or templates.
  • Admin logins from unfamiliar IP addresses or geographies.
  • Spikes in error rates or system resource usage post-exploitation attempts.

Post-Compromise Handling: Incident Containment and Recovery

  1. Containment: Place your site in maintenance mode; rotate all credentials and restrict network access.
  2. Forensic Collection: Preserve logs and create backups for detailed investigation.
  3. Eradication: Remove malicious files, unauthorized users, and backdoors; restore clean code from trusted sources.
  4. Recovery: Restore from clean backups, fully update plugins/themes/core, and reapply hardening configurations.
  5. Post-Incident Review: Conduct root cause analysis and implement improvements to prevent recurrence.

Engage professional security incident responders when internal expertise is limited.


Strengthening Defenses: Best Practices and Hardening

  • Apply Least Privilege: Limit administrative accounts and user roles strictly.
  • Plugin Hygiene: Remove unused plugins/themes and choose those with strong security track records.
  • Keep Systems Updated: Enable automated updates and streamline patch workflows.
  • Manage Secrets Securely: Enforce strong passwords and 2FA; rotate keys regularly.
  • Harden File System: Disable PHP execution in uploads directories; disable theme/plugin file editing from WordPress admin.
  • Monitor and Log: Enable detailed logging with offsite retention and monitor for anomalous activity.
  • Maintain Reliable Backups: Use tested, immutable backups stored separately.

Role of Web Application Firewalls (WAF) and Virtual Patching

A modern WAF is a strategic defense layer that mitigates risks immediately after a vulnerability disclosure, buying critical time for proper patch deployment.

Managed-WP delivers:

  1. Virtual Patching: Rapid deployment of tailored rules that block known exploit signatures and suspicious behaviors.
  2. Managed Rule Updates: Continuous updates to address new and emerging threats specific to WordPress plugins.
  3. Layered Security: Rate limiting, IP reputation filtering, and behavioral analysis reduce attack surface.
  4. Malware Detection and Removal: Proactive scanning and cleaning tools integrated directly into our service.
  5. Session and Brute-Force Controls: Automated enforcement of session invalidation and login throttling during active attacks.

While WAFs are not a substitute for patching, they are an indispensable compensating control to reduce exposure.


Guidance for Developers: Avoiding Privilege Escalation Mistakes

  1. Never Trust Client Input: Rigorously validate and sanitize all requests server-side.
  2. Enforce Capability Checks: Properly verify user permissions with WordPress APIs before sensitive operations.
  3. Use Nonces Effectively: Prevent CSRF by verifying nonces on all state-altering actions.
  4. Secure AJAX and REST APIs: Require authentication and strict permission callbacks.
  5. Implement Least Privilege in Logic: Never elevate permissions based on client-side input alone.
  6. Ship Secure Defaults: Configure plugins with safe settings and clear, secure upgrade paths.
  7. Conduct Security Testing: Include permission checks in automated tests and seek external code audits.

Recommendations for Hosting Providers and Agencies

  • Maintain Plugin Inventories: Automated tools to track and flag vulnerable plugin versions across sites.
  • Prioritize Critical Site Updates: Focus on public-facing and high-value sites first.
  • Automate Safe Update Pipelines: Promote rapid patch deployment with minimal downtime.
  • Apply Network-Level Protections: Use gateway or CDN-level WAFs to reduce mass exploitation risks.
  • Enforce Account and File Isolation: Secure multi-tenant environments with strict boundaries.
  • Communicate Risk Transparently: Keep clients informed about vulnerabilities and mitigation timelines.

Secure Your Site Today — Try Managed-WP Basic (Free)

Managed-WP offers immediate, essential WordPress site protections at no cost, including:

  • Managed Web Application Firewall (WAF)
  • Unlimited bandwidth-based protection
  • Malware scanning capabilities
  • Active mitigation of common WordPress security risks

Sign up now to enable hands-off firewall protection and vulnerability mitigation: https://managed-wp.com/pricing

Upgrade to paid plans to unlock automated malware removal, IP filtering, virtual patching, and expert remediation assistance.


Operational Checklist: What to Do Right Now

  1. Update Modular DS to version 2.6.0 or remove/disable immediately if unable to update.
  2. If unable to update immediately:
    • Disable the Modular DS plugin.
    • Enable virtual patching and WAF rules targeting this vulnerability.
  3. Reset all administrative passwords and rotate API keys.
  4. Run comprehensive malware scans and file integrity checks.
  5. Review and preserve logs for suspicious activity.
  6. Audit administrator accounts and remove unauthorized users.
  7. Reinstall WordPress core, themes, and plugins from trusted sources if compromise suspected.
  8. Enforce two-factor authentication for all privileged accounts.
  9. Implement centralized logging and secure retention policies.

Appendix: WP-CLI Commands for Rapid Response

Utilize these WP-CLI commands cautiously, after ensuring backups and proper understanding:

  • Check plugin status:
    wp plugin status modular-connector
  • Update the plugin:
    wp plugin update modular-connector --version=2.6.0
  • Deactivate the plugin:
    wp plugin deactivate modular-connector
  • List administrator users:
    wp user list --role=administrator --fields=ID,user_login,user_email,display_name
  • Force logout all users:
    wp user session destroy --all
    (Alternatively, rotate authentication keys in wp-config.php.)
  • Enable maintenance mode (basic):
    wp option update blog_public 0
  • Backup site files:
    rsync -az --delete /var/www/html/ /backup/path/site-$(date +%F)

Note: Adjust commands for your environment and ensure proper permissions.


Final Thoughts from the Managed-WP Security Team

Privilege escalation vulnerabilities that require no authentication represent among the highest risks in the WordPress ecosystem. Their exploitability and impact necessitate swift, coordinated response.

Individual site owners must patch immediately. Managed service providers should leverage virtual patching and automated mitigations for rapid risk reduction across large fleets. Complementary measures—patching, WAF, monitoring, and operational discipline—offer the strongest security posture.

Managed-WP equips you with a robust, multi-layered defense including managed WAF rules, instantaneous virtual patching, malware detection, and expert remediation options. Begin with our Basic free plan for immediate protection and scale according to your security needs.

Your security integrity is only as strong as your unpatched components. Act decisively and seek expert assistance if needed.

Stay secure,
Managed-WP Security Team


If you would like a printable incident response checklist consolidated in a convenient PDF, please leave a comment and we will prepare one for your reference.


Take Proactive Action — Secure Your Site with Managed-WP

Don’t risk your business or reputation due to overlooked plugin flaws or weak permissions. Managed-WP provides robust Web Application Firewall (WAF) protection, tailored vulnerability response, and hands-on remediation for WordPress security that goes far beyond standard hosting services.

Exclusive Offer for Blog Readers: Access our MWPv1r1 protection plan—industry-grade security starting from just USD20/month.

  • Automated virtual patching and advanced role-based traffic filtering
  • Personalized onboarding and step-by-step site security checklist
  • Real-time monitoring, incident alerts, and priority remediation support
  • Actionable best-practice guides for secrets management and role hardening

Get Started Easily — Secure Your Site for USD20/month:
Protect My Site with Managed-WP MWPv1r1 Plan

Why trust Managed-WP?

  • Immediate coverage against newly discovered plugin and theme vulnerabilities
  • Custom WAF rules and instant virtual patching for high-risk scenarios
  • Concierge onboarding, expert remediation, and best-practice advice whenever you need it

Don’t wait for the next security breach. Safeguard your WordPress site and reputation with Managed-WP—the choice for businesses serious about security.

Click above to start your protection today (MWPv1r1 plan, USD20/month).
https://managed-wp.com/pricing


Popular Posts